Necessary Supplies for Launching Your Fungi Farm
To begin your own mushroom operation , you'll require a few essential supplies. First, you'll need a clean read more workspace – this could be a room or a dedicated area . Then comes the growing medium , such as coco coir, which acts as food for your fungi . You'll also require a moisture control system, typically involving a mister and a dampness gauge. Finally, don't forget suitable ventilation, often provided by a blower . Such things are essential for a thriving start.

Eco-friendly Mushroom Growing Resources: Sustainable Choices
Building a profitable mushroom operation demands careful consideration beyond just the base. Growing numbers of growers are looking for environmentally-friendly approaches for their supplies . Traditionally, numerous mushroom farms have relied on conventional goods that may have a large ecological impact . Fortunately, a range of eco-friendly choices are now obtainable. Here's a concise look at some:
- Substrate – Explore near-me agricultural byproducts like hay , timber shavings , or java waste.
- Growing Containers – Use reused material or earth-friendly options like coconut material .
- Water – Implement water-wise techniques like drip application or collecting precipitation .
- Disinfectants – Investigate organic disinfectants derived from botanical extracts instead of aggressive chemicals .
Embracing these sustainable approaches not only reduces your ecological footprint but can also improve your operation’s standing and attract environmentally-conscious consumers .

Troubleshooting Your Mushroom Farm: Supply Checklist
Maintaining a flourishing mushroom farm requires more than just knowledge; it demands a meticulous approach. When challenges arise, a swift diagnosis often points to a minor supply deficit. This list outlines a comprehensive supply checklist to help you pinpoint potential gaps and get your farm back on schedule. Carefully review these items regularly, and proactive maintenance will significantly reduce the chance of harvest failure.
- Substrate: Ensure a sufficient quantity of your chosen base.
- Spawn: Verify you have enough seed for future flushes.
- Humidity control: Check readings and functionality.
- Ventilation: Inspect vents and blowers.
- UV: Confirm intensity is adequate.
- Containers: Make sure you have enough for new batches.
- Cleaning supplies: Maintain a sterile environment with required agents.
- Hygrometer: Measure conditions.
